Allies in World War II

The Allies in World War II implemented comprehensive sustainment strategies that were critical to their success. A striking example is the logistical cooperation between the United States and the United Kingdom, which facilitated the effective supply of equipment, food, and fuel across multiple fronts. This coordination exemplified the importance of sustainment strategies in warfare.

Utilizing the Lend-Lease program, the Allies ensured that resources flowed efficiently to those who needed them most, including the Soviet Union. This program not only bolstered military capabilities but also streamlined supply chains, demonstrating how collaboration can enhance sustainment efforts.

The Allies faced significant challenges, including frequent attacks on supply lines and the vast distances involved. However, their adaptability allowed them to establish alternate routes and implement innovative strategies, such as the use of Mulberry harbors during the D-Day invasion to maintain supply flow despite adverse conditions.

Overall, the Allies’ approach during World War II highlights the vital role of sustainment strategies in warfare. Their ability to effectively manage supply chains and respond to challenges ultimately contributed to their decisive victories in various campaigns.

Terrain Considerations

Terrain considerations significantly influence sustainment strategies in warfare. The physical landscape can affect supply routes, logistics planning, and overall operational effectiveness. Different terrain types, such as mountains, deserts, and urban environments, present unique challenges that military planners must navigate.

In mountainous regions, narrow passes and steep inclines complicate transportation and supply delivery. Here, commanders may need to rely on alternative transport methods, such as aerial resupply, to maintain operational momentum. Similarly, desert terrains often lack water sources and require extensive planning for provisioning troops and vehicles.

Urban warfare introduces its own set of obstacles, including traffic congestion and infrastructure damage. Effective sustainment strategies in such environments demand coordination with civil authorities and consideration for civilian populations. Ensuring the availability of food, water, and medical supplies becomes critical in sustaining combat operations in densely populated areas.

Overall, terrain considerations are integral to the development of sustainment strategies in warfare. Understanding the geographical challenges enables military forces to design strategies that optimize their logistical capabilities and ensure mission success.
